Output dbab3fa3a82f882d9e814928cedeb775c4d1d1ea5e75348e92c0feb67ab75760:25

value
10583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7f7c275a9f213e1d31b2237c712c2e244cd9d66 OP_EQUAL
address
3H19aDeF5vx274snMdXbfm47ExDPg7yUwj
transaction
dbab3fa3a82f882d9e814928cedeb775c4d1d1ea5e75348e92c0feb67ab75760
spent
true